Workplace Injuries & Leave: Knowing Your Legal Options

Experiencing a business harm can be devastating and confusing, especially when it concerns receiving leave from a position. Understanding your here protections under federal laws is extremely important. Employees may be qualified for workers’ compensation, which offers healthcare and income substitute. Additionally, employees might possess protection against retaliation if workers make a petition. Consulting a knowledgeable lawyer can assist them deal with this intricate process and ensure your legal rights.

Understanding Labor Law : A Family Medical & Safety Perspective

Ensuring compliance with employment law concerning personal leave, medical accommodations, and workplace security is paramount for any company. Employers must diligently understand and adhere to the complexities of laws like the FMLA and the Disability Law, as well as state regulations regarding time off and employee benefits. Providing a secure workplace that accommodates employee requirements – whether related to health or family responsibilities – is not only legally mandated but also fosters a productive organizational climate.
